Mise-en-scène #3: Rain

February 6, 2015

Ebook of Made You Up by Francesca Zappia in the rain

Sometimes waiting for a highly anticipated book feels like being left out in the rain. (Made You Up by Francesca Zappia will be published May 19, 2015.) Still, if there’s one thing I love, it’s rainy nights. The air is fresh and cool as I sit by my window and curl up in bed to read. When I’m, done reading, the rain becomes a lullaby that rocks me to sleep.

Behind the Scene

For this week, I have to say the theme stumped me. It didn’t rain over the past two weeks save for last Wednesday afternoon when I was cooped up in a warehouse. I had almost resigned myself to a rainless photo when last night, I realized I didn’t have to wait for rain. I could “make it rain” myself!

As Gumperson’s Law goes, of course, it was raining when I woke up a few hours ago. At least this pushed my creativity with resources available to me.
